久久久国产一区二区_国产精品av电影_日韩精品中文字幕一区二区三区_精品一区二区三区免费毛片爱
機械社區
標題:
自定義截面梁,怎么進行優化
[打印本頁]
作者:
鹿1029
時間:
2013-10-2 13:12
標題:
自定義截面梁,怎么進行優化
梁的優化是很多ANSYS教材的例程,使用箱形梁,以梁的板厚為變量,尋求梁質量的最小化。
$ `0 M$ G/ g0 \; u! j
我這里唯一的不同是使用了自己定義的一個截面,截面外形尺寸固定,所以截面形狀的變化主要與梁的板厚相關聯。
: B, n. |* l4 a
優化程序主要包括三部分:
a9 y* T8 T n$ g. o
(1)定義截面形狀和分網;
+ r/ ]) W* ^2 q" l$ Z3 h7 p8 G1 d( c
(2)大梁建模,加載和靜力求解;
# B" T" l* p) q" x% ^
(3)提取梁單元體積、截面應力、節點位移,進行優化
) D7 H. B- o$ x5 F$ M/ O( X& V6 X
$ z$ P& k) o- d: ?% r* x7 o
問題出現在這里:優化時需要不斷的調整設計變量(板厚),也即每次都要建立相應的截面并進行靜力求解分析。截面建立完成,其節點等需要刪除,但其使用的板厚尺寸又需要保留給后續使用。
: @2 e8 T' e% }, F: ~
5 ]( W6 R' ^! f
我嘗試不刪除截面,直接定義兩種單元,單元一Plane82給截面,單元二Beam188大梁建模,但這樣大梁模型中混雜著梁的截面,多出一個面;
9 U6 Y" o$ E& W, t2 ~( t
又嘗試在完成截面定義時,在/clear(清除節點等)前使用PARSAV保存參數,其后使用PARRES恢復參數,但又出現新的問題:優化時狀態變量(應力、撓度(節點位移))和目標函數(體積)不隨設計變量(板厚)變化而變化,二者沒有了關聯性。
6 M U {! t& I8 S7 A! Y/ F0 z
/ ^! b) Q8 ?: J/ }/ j$ x$ D
歡迎光臨 機械社區 (http://www.ytsybjq.com/)
Powered by Discuz! X3.5